summ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D17
1 files changed, 6 insertions, 11 deletions
diff --git a/PKGBUILD b/PKGBUILD
index fcf990776fac..a9cd4bcde56d 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-7,8 +7,8 @@ arch=('x86_64')
url="https://github.com/Spu7Nix/SPWN-language.git"
license=('MIT')
groups=()
-depends=(rust)
-makedepends=(git cargo libgit2)
+depends=(rust libgit2)
+makedepends=(git cargo)
checkdepends=()
optdepends=()
provides=()
@@ -30,14 +30,9 @@ package() {
mkdir -p "${pkgdir}/usr/bin/spwn-bin/libraries"
install -Dm755 "${srcdir}/SPWN-language/target/release/spwn" "${pkgdir}/usr/bin/spwn-bin/spwn"
+ install -Dm755 "${srcdir}/SPWN-language/target/release/spwn" "${pkgdir}/usr/bin/spwn"
+ install -Dm644 "${srcdir}/SPWN-language/LICENSE" "${pkgdir}/usr/share/licenses/$pkgname/LICENSE"
+
cp -r "${srcdir}/SPWN-language/libraries/" "${pkgdir}/usr/bin/spwn-bin/"
chmod -R 644 "${pkgdir}/usr/bin/spwn-bin/libraries"
-}
-
-post_install(){
- ln -s "${pkgdir}/usr/bin/spwn-bin/spwn" "${pkgdir}/usr/bin/spwn"
-}
-
-post_remove() {
- unlink /usr/bin/spwn
-}
+} \ No newline at end of file